WebMay 1, 2010 · Only E. coli O157:H7 RM 1908 and 3704 persisted after 7 days exposure to spinach shoots. No E. coli O157:H7 strains were recovered from spinach shoots on 14, 21 and 28 days postinoculation. In soil, all E. coli O157:H7 strains with initial concentrations at c. 6·5 log CFU 200 g soil −1 declined over time but persisted through the 28‐day study. WebSteps to growing spinach Get good spinach seeds Prepare a garden bed or container with rich, fertile soil Sow spinach seeds about ½-1” apart when the soil temperature is cool Water regularly Keep weeds at bay Thin the spinach seedlings to 4”-6” apart Fertilize and mulch as needed Harvest outer leaves as they mature
